> Frank-
>
> The easiest thing to do is to set the backup bit on all your programs that
> the user installs and any data files your programs creates.
>
> For the former, if you're using MW, it's an option in one of the linker
> panels. If you're using GCC, it's fairly easy to write a post-build command
> that just sets the appropriate bit in the output PRC.
>
> For the latter, call PalmOS call DmSetDatabaseInfo() to set the backup bit
> for your "data files" after creating them on the palm device. (You could
> also use this technique to set the backup bit for program files).
Thank you for your help. However, I do set the backup bit for all
data files programmatically. I cannot seem to find the .pdb files anywhere
on the hard disk after a HotSync, however. Of course, with backupbuddy
everything is all peachy, but...I think something this basic should
be doable with the standard software.
